Born on June 7, 1920, Mum witnessed dramatic changes
in the world and learned from it all. She had limited access
to formal education but instilled its value in her family and was
proud of our accomplishments. She enjoyed her career in administration
at the Charlottetown Hospital. She was an exceptional cook,
a gracious host and knew how to stretch a dollar farther than a pair
of pantyhose!
